ADRIAN — The Rollin–Woodstock Sanitary Drainage Board will meet next week to review matters related to local stormwater management and drainage operations.

The session is scheduled for Thursday, December 4, from 2:30 to 3:30 p.m., and will take place at the Lenawee County Drain Commissioner’s Office, located at 320 Springbrook Avenue, Suite 102 in Adrian.

The board typically oversees maintenance, infrastructure coordination and funding for the district’s drainage system. Thursday’s meeting will be open to the public and will address current management issues affecting both Rollin and Woodstock townships.

No agenda details have been provided ahead of the meeting.

Residents with questions or concerns about drainage conditions may attend or contact the Drain Commissioner’s Office for additional information.
